Hi
May not be an Ideal solution but define a key in the registry with a string value with the IP Address and use the following function
=getregistrystring('H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\QlikTech\QlikView','IP')

What I exactly looking for was, my client has two separate servers for Production & UAT. (Normal Case)
Both the servers has qlikview server installed on it. Its a constant support environment where we do development as per user requirement & send them UAT Server URL for data validation. & once UAT is done we update (upload) the application on Production server.
we gave users the direct accesspoint URL of application.
There were some applications that interconnected to each other & user can navigate it through button click. (URL was placed into button action -Open Qlikview Document)
So,If I could get server IP address at front end, then I could set it into a variable, & without changing a single line of code, application will work fine on both the servers.
PS. My requirement was completed since we applied simple approach of writing QlikView Application Name
instead of writing complete URL. (for this,both the applications should be in same folder.)
